Drum Tower

(4 of 6 of Hutong and the Back Lakes)
The narrow lanes are quiet. He passes by a few people. Now and then, the rare pedicab, trishaw and bicycle. A few elderly men sit by the lake waiting for the telling jerk of their fishing rods. The alleyways leading to siheyuans - once occupied by a single family, now four - are filled with things that can't fit inside their small homes. A delinquent mop. A forlorn cupboard.
